AMICOS, the spanish leader of the INC-LEISURE project aims to provide to all participants an experience of participation, training, analysis and reflection on the non-formal inclusive spaces of learning, not only as a solution to a problem of social exclusion of the children’s school community, but also as a way of learning values and transversal competences within the formal school education. The non-formal education is the one received in places of daily life and social relations, such as school playgrounds, parks and sports areas. More specifically, the INC-LEISURE project pursues the following objectives:

 Reduce early school drop-out derived from the social exclusion that affects the groups at risk of exclusion, especially the young people with disabilities, in the non-formal learning spaces.

 Promote equal opportunities for girls and boys through the inclusive leisure activities.

 Improve the knowledge of transversal school subjects and competences (mathematics, history, coresponsibility, initiative, etc.) through educational and participatory activities in the non-formal learning spaces.

 Raise awareness and visibility regarding the importance and richness that diversity brings to the community and the environment.
